My dyno with stock Tune through the Cats and LoudMouth Cat back was 378rwhp 365rwtq. Anyways today we tuned the car and it made 383rwhp 377rwtq with no cats, but through the Hooker catback. After that i opened the cutout that is located in the I-pipe and it made 391.7rwhp 381.8rwtq.... The graph before and after the tune is like adding another cam over the cam i have thanks to Jeff at F-Body Central. Anyways i will post the links to the graphs below:

Its 224/230 .587 .593 114LSA. U can say its a mild cam by today's standards. After the tuning the car runs very well and its very hard to tell i have a cam in it. I like the fact it made 392rwhp 382rwtq with no pulleys and TB. Im sure with these two mods i will be over the 400rwhp mark, but im going after the ATI so the pulleys wont do me good. Maybe i will port the TB later to make up for the power im going to lose from the heavier Drive Shaft.
